Key Takeaways
- Utility and Value: Altcoins with clear utility and real value attract dedicated users and foster strong community engagement, ensuring long-term sustainability.
- Adaptability: Successful altcoins continuously adapt to market trends and technological innovations, maintaining relevance in a dynamic cryptocurrency landscape.
- Security Measures: Projects that implement strong security features and undergo thorough audits build trust and credibility, which is essential for longevity.
- Regulatory Compliance: Adherence to regulations enhances credibility and stability, helping altcoins avoid legal issues and attract institutional interest.
- Active Community Engagement: A robust and engaged community advocates for the project, driving visibility, innovation, and a sense of belonging among users.

As the cryptocurrency market evolves, you may find yourself wondering which altcoins will stand the test of time. With thousands of options available, it’s crucial to identify the key factors that contribute to an altcoin’s longevity. Understanding what makes some coins stick around can help you make smarter investment decisions.
First, consider the importance of utility tokens. These tokens serve a specific purpose within their respective ecosystems, providing real value to users. When an altcoin has a clear utility, it’s more likely to attract a dedicated user base. This engagement fosters a sense of community, which is significant. A strong community not only supports the project but also actively participates in its growth. You’ll often find that altcoins with robust community engagement tend to thrive, as users advocate for the project and its long-term goals.
Utility tokens play a crucial role in fostering dedicated user communities, driving engagement and long-term support for altcoin projects.
Next, pay attention to market trends. The cryptocurrency landscape is dynamic, and what’s popular today may not be relevant tomorrow. Altcoins that adapt to these trends, incorporating technological innovation, are more likely to last. If a coin’s development team is continuously improving the technology behind it, you can be more confident in its future. Look for projects that integrate features like smart contracts or are exploring layer-two solutions to enhance scalability. These innovations can set a coin apart from others that may stagnate. Additionally, technological innovation can help a project stay competitive and relevant in a rapidly changing market. Staying adaptable by embracing new developments can significantly influence an altcoin’s long-term viability. Moreover, projects that prioritize scalability solutions are better positioned to handle growth and increased adoption over time. Recognizing the importance of technological progress can also give you insight into a project’s potential for longevity.
Security features are another critical aspect. In a world where cyber threats are rampant, an altcoin that prioritizes security can gain your trust. Projects that implement strong security measures protect user assets and data, making them more appealing. When you see a coin that has undergone thorough audits and has a track record of safeguarding its users, it’s worth your attention. Additionally, security vulnerabilities are a major concern that can undermine a project’s credibility and longevity. Addressing these vulnerabilities proactively is essential for maintaining user confidence.
Lastly, regulatory compliance can’t be overlooked. As governments worldwide begin to establish frameworks for cryptocurrency, altcoins that align themselves with these regulations will likely fare better in the long run. Compliance not only builds credibility but also helps prevent potential legal issues that could jeopardize a project. Staying ahead of regulatory developments can be a vital factor in ensuring an altcoin’s sustained presence in the market. Being proactive in regulatory compliance demonstrates a commitment to stability and longevity. Recognizing the importance of legal adherence can also influence partnerships and institutional interest in the project.

Frequently Asked Questions
How Do I Choose Which Altcoins to Invest In?
To choose which altcoins to invest in, start by analyzing market trends and understanding investor sentiment. Look for projects showcasing technology innovation with clear use cases. Evaluate their regulatory impact, as this can greatly affect their viability. Don’t forget to perform a liquidity analysis; verify you can easily buy or sell your chosen altcoins. Balancing these factors will help you make informed decisions and potentially increase your investment success.
What Role Do Developers Play in an Altcoin’s Longevity?
Think of developers as gardeners tending to a vibrant ecosystem. Their engagement shapes an altcoin’s future. When they regularly roll out code updates and embrace innovation trends, they keep the project thriving. Community involvement acts like sunlight, nurturing growth and attracting new users. Without dedicated developers, an altcoin risks wilting away, losing its relevance. So, watch for those who cultivate their projects—these are the ones likely to flourish for years to come.
Are There Specific Markets Where Altcoins Perform Better?
Yes, certain markets allow altcoins to thrive better. High trading volume and positive investor sentiment boost their performance. You’ll find that altcoins with clear use cases often align with market trends and technological advancements, attracting more interest. Additionally, a favorable regulatory environment can enhance their stability and longevity. When you keep an eye on these factors, you’ll spot opportunities for altcoins that are likely to succeed in specific markets.
How Does Community Support Impact an Altcoin’s Success?
Community support greatly impacts an altcoin’s success. In fact, projects with strong community engagement can experience up to a 200% increase in user participation. When you’re active in forums and social media, you’ll notice how user feedback shapes governance models and project transparency. A dedicated community fosters a long-term vision, creating network effects that drive adoption. Ultimately, the more engaged the community, the more likely the altcoin will thrive over time.
What Are the Risks of Investing in Lesser-Known Altcoins?
Investing in lesser-known altcoins carries several risks. You face market volatility that can drastically impact your investment’s value. Regulatory changes might also arise, creating uncertainty. Additionally, technological innovation can render a project obsolete. Without project transparency, it’s tough to gauge the altcoin’s viability. Liquidity concerns may limit your ability to sell, and shifting investor sentiment can lead to sudden price drops. Always do thorough research before diving in.
